Monday 28 February 2011: A host of golden ......

A day early but these daffodils caught my eye, and look .... there's an abandoned house in the background as well! This was taken in the neighbouring village of Kilcrohane which once had a blooming (!!) co-operative that was famous for producing the earliest daffs in the British Isles. For some reason, the co-operative folded some years ago and now the fields of daffodils are just left unattended and unloved but much admired by this passing blipper. I wanted to gather up armfuls but nobody misses a thing down there! The house is interesting too - apparently one of the oldest in the village but now in need of a lot of love and attention. I have had a snoop but was unable to get in!
